I was in the DN track day the same day as you, and agree, the driving standards were great, very respectful and quite safe. However only your Caterham and mine where there, so I fully support initiatives like these to have more cars alike in the Ring.

It's true that DN "does not accept novices but just experienced track day drivers", which helps on the driving standards side, but limits those who want to have the first experience in the Ring. Anyhow I have nothing but positives to say about Darren and their operation.

The other great option is RSR, who as well provides tuition. I'd say they are the "masters" of the Ring in terms of organizing events, providing tuition and even rentals. Maybe I am biased because I know them and use their services in the Ring and Spa, but in any case it is another option to consider in case the dates offered by DN doe not work. And both organizers get along well and support each other.

I think the "exit corner, check your mirrors for radicals, move to the right if on a straight, don't dive the inside, don't go round the outside" that we all learn pretty quickly on trackdays is worth much much more than having done 1000 laps on a computer game. I have zero interest in TF
